Model CCI Simulation Exercise in Quetta

QUETTA, PAKISTAN: The Hanns Seidel Foundation (HSF) Pakistan has successfully conducted the fifth Balochistan simulation exercise of Model CCI 2021-23 in collaboration with the Balochistan University of Information Technology, Engineering and Management Sciences (BUITEMS) in Quetta on 4 August 2022.  

The chief guest at the simulation exercise, Dr. Nisar Ahmad, Director, National Incubation Center, BUITEMS, stressed the importance of trainings like Model CCI for the development of students:

Model CCI proves to be a platform for students to showcase how politically, socially and economically aware they are about Pakistan and its problems. It provides students with an excellent opportunity to indulge in a dialogue with their fellows, and it will help them boosting their confidence, and hence will help them in becoming future leaders.

40 students selected from the Model CCI training workshop from diverse academic programs participated in the academic one-day activity. The students presented and discussed their policy recommendations on different political, social, and economic topics in Pakistan.

Three jury members selected the five best performing students based on standardized criteria. These selected students will further compete in the next Model CCI rounds in the provincial or federal capitals.
